Abstract

The interactions between a gemini surfactant 12-2-12 and bovine serum albumin (BSA) have been studied in aqueous and mixed aqueous media by conductance measurements using the iterative method at different temperatures ranging from 298.15 K to 313.15 K with step size 5. The critical micellar concentration (CMC) as well as the degree of ionization for the micelles (α) have been evaluated and their variation with solvent type and temperature has been discussed. The error for conductivity measurements was calculated and found to be much smaller than for surface tension measurements using the platinum ring method. The CMC values for the mixture of 12-2-12 and BSA in aqueous solvent solutions follow the sequence: DMF > AN > DMSO > water. These values were further confirmed by surface tension studies. From the thermodynamic parameters, hydrophobic interactions were found to be the driving force for micellization. The existence of enthalpy-entropy compensation was established from the linear plot of ΔH° m and ΔS° m .
